Kinotech Solar Energy Corporation was established in April 2002 by Dr. Yoshihiro Kino under his prospectus of incorporation that the company would provide the state of the art technology and products helpful for frontier research and development.

Since 2005, the company had been, among other things, concentrating on the development of the Zinc Reduction Process (Du Pont Process )technology to produce Polysilicon used as a raw materials for Crystal Silicon Solar Battery and in Jan. of 2008, concluded joint development agreement with a certain chemical company in Japan . However , because of uncertain feasibility of the Polysilicon project in respect of economical competitiveness to the conventional process , the company have decided to suspend the project and now have been seeking new business fields making use of our Electrolysis Process. Now, the company are looking for the partners having an interests to develop Electrolysis Process applicable for Rare Earth , Titanium and Other Metals Refineries .

Our Electrolysis Process is one process of Zinc Reduction Process

Zinc Reduction Process was developed by Du Pont in 1951 and also developed byBattelle Columbus Laboratories in USA as the project of the Department of Energy (DOE) for 1970-1980. Our Electrolysis Process is one process of Zinc Reduction Process composed of 3 Process.

chemical formula

As stated on above , Metal Silicon as raw material are reacted with Chlorine at Chlorination Process and SiCl4 will be produced . And, SiCl4 is reducted by Zinc(Zn) and Final Product (Polysilicon) are produced . ZnCl2 is separated to Zn and Cl2 at Zinc Chloride Electrolysis Process. Key point of the technology is how efficiently ZnCl2 will be separated because the volume of ZnCl2 is 10 times as Polysilicon in quantity. Summarizing the process, it is CLOSED PROCESS without producing by-products and just by adding Metal Silicon as raw materials and the minimum quantity of Chlorine and Zinc lost during processing .

Our Electrolysis Process

Our Electrolysis Process is Molten Salt Electrolysis without supporting electrolytes. Our Demister technology is very effective for the consecutive operation of Electrolysis Process.
